Job Description:

Each Residential College has a team consisting of a Residential College Lead and Residential Advisors. Under the direct supervision of the Residential College Lead, RA’s are responsible for nurturing a safe and welcoming YYGS community, promoting the safety and security of YYGS participants and staff, and facilitating residential activities in their residential college, Program Office, and throughout Yale’s campus. The academic-focused RA’s will also have other (varied) responsibilities including attending and assisting with lectures, seminars, symposium and/or helping the YYGS Program Managers (PMs)and Instructional Staff as needed.

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Work regular shifts in the Program Office (which is the participant hub for everything non-academic from lost keys and maintenance issues to sign in/out and roommate conflicts. It is also the instructor hub for A/V support and classroom needs.)
  • Ensure the safety and security of all participants, and promote program rules including attendance expectations, behavior, curfew, good health hygiene, and boundaries.
  • Provide support and positive role modeling for participants.
  • Support Residential College Lead and YYGS Instructional Staff with coordination and implementation of the following activities (list is subject to change): YYGS Family Time, Lectures, Symposium, Panel Presentations, Speaker Series, Student Showcase, Recreational Activities, End of Session Party, Free Time, and Special Meals.
  • Communicate concerns in a timely fashion.
  • Academic-focused RAs will be responsible for providing technical and administrative support to instructors and lecturers. They will set up lecture presentations and be the point person for technology requests, as well as assist instructors with Audio/Visual equipment in real time. YYGS PMs will lean on these RAs to assist with any academic-related duties.
  • Perform other related functions at the direction of the Residential Life Manager, Residential College Lead, and YYGS Leadership Team.
